SubjectRe: [PATCH v2 4/8] dt-bindings: clock: arm,syscon-icst: Use 'reg' instead of 'vco-offset' for VCO register address
On Mon, Sep 13, 2021 at 9:28 PM Rob Herring <robh@kernel.org> wrote:

> 'reg' is the standard property for defining register banks/addresses. Add
> it to use for the VCO register address and deprecate 'vco-offset'. This
> will also allow for using standard node names with unit-addresses.
